Understanding Cutting Tool Design Principles

To obtain best cutting results, a thorough knowledge of cutting tool design principles is critical. The configuration – including aspects like rake, clearance degree, and bottom slope – directly influences the severance operation. Deliberate consideration must be given to structure choice, layering approaches, and the planned application, as these components determine tool longevity and the standard of the finished component. Finally, a well-designed cutting tool provides better throughput and reduced costs.

Cutting Tool Selection: Optimizing Performance

Selecting the new cutting tools ideal machining tool is vital for guaranteeing optimal efficiency and extending wear resistance . Considerations include the material to be processed , its density, the intended quality, and the available tooling system . Proper picking of the shape, surface treatment and grade significantly impacts cycle time and total operational expenditure. Additionally, a complete assessment of the loads is necessary for avoiding premature damage and ensuring a secure working environment .
